1. Continuous Hot Water Supply: Endless Comfort on Demand
Tankless water heaters redefine the hot water experience by providing a continuous and on-demand supply. Unlike traditional water heaters with limited storage capacities, tankless systems heat water as it flows through the unit. This ensures that you have hot water whenever you need it, whether it’s for a long shower, running multiple appliances simultaneously, or filling a large bathtub. 2. Energy Efficiency: A Greener Plumbing Solution
One of the standout advantages of tankless water heaters lies in their superior energy efficiency. Traditional tank-style heaters constantly heat a large volume of water, resulting in standby heat losses. In contrast, tankless heaters only activate when hot water is requested, eliminating the need to continuously keep a reservoir hot. This on-demand heating approach translates to substantial energy savings and a smaller carbon footprint. 3. Space-Saving Design: Optimal Utilization of Square Footage
Modern living often demands efficient use of space, and tankless water heaters deliver on that front. Their compact and wall-mounted designs free up valuable square footage compared to bulky traditional water heaters with storage tanks. This space-saving advantage is particularly valuable in urban apartments, smaller homes, or where space utilization is a priority. Tankless water heaters offer flexibility in installation locations, allowing homeowners to optimize their living spaces without compromising on hot water comfort.
4. Extended Lifespan: Long-Term Durability
Tankless water heaters boast a longer lifespan compared to traditional water heaters. Tankless systems can last up to 20 years with the right maintenance, compared to the normal 10 to 15 years for tank-style heaters. This long-term durability not only reduces the frequency of replacements but also contributes to cost savings over the life of the unit. 6. Reduced Risk of Water Damage: Leak Prevention
Unlike traditional water heaters with storage tanks, tankless systems minimize the risk of water damage caused by leaks or ruptures. The absence of a large reservoir eliminates the potential for catastrophic flooding. This is especially advantageous for homeowners concerned about water damage and mold growth. How do tankless water heaters save energy?
Tankless water heaters operate on-demand, heating water only when needed. This eliminates standby energy losses seen in traditional water heaters, resulting in significant energy savings and a more environmentally friendly plumbing solution.
